The rollover of a TopBuild 401k to a new employer plan still requires a multi-step process that can involve mail-based transactions, which can cause significant delays, even with the growing digitization of financial activities. Though these delays may seem like small inconveniences, they can have a substantial effect on long-term retirement savings. Delays in rolling over your 401k could result in considerable losses, especially over time, as a result of missed opportunities for market growth, according to a recent analysis by PensionBee. 1

Delays in rollover could result in lost returns of $76,000.

Even though it might not seem urgent to act right away, delaying a 401k rollover for even a brief period of time can have serious financial consequences. According to a survey by PensionBee, even short delays of two to eight weeks can cost tens of thousands of dollars in missed profits, particularly when the market is volatile. The study examined how processing delays affected 401k balances and found that, over a 30-year period, an eight-week wait could cost someone with a $100,000 balance up to $76,000. Similarly, this same delay could result in a loss of $38,442 for a $50,000 balance and a loss of $7,688 for a $10,000 balance.

Even brief delays can make a difference. Over a 30-year period, a TopBuild employee with a $100,000 401k balance could potentially lose $37,512 due to a two-week wait. This emphasizes the importance of taking quick action to keep your retirement funds steadily invested and growing. Since even a short time away from the market can compound losses over time, one of the main principles of retirement planning is time in the market, not timing the market.

The Dangers of Postponing Your TopBuild 401k Rollover

Whether you are just starting work with TopBuild, or leaving the company for a new job or retirement, delaying your 401k rollover can come with financial consequences that extend beyond missed profits. One potential risk is losing track of old accounts, which could result in unnecessary fees or even automatic cash-outs. Over 30 million retirement funds remain unclaimed, according to PensionBee’s founder and CEO, Romi Savova. Individuals often leave behind multiple accounts when changing jobs, which typically occurs 12 times during their careers. Those who unintentionally fail to roll over their old accounts may find themselves facing unnecessary fines.

Delaying the rollover might also lead to penalties that reduce the value of your assets, in addition to the possibility of losing track of retirement funds. While TopBuild might cover some of your 401k expenses during employment, these obligations typically transfer to the account holder after you leave the company. These fees have the potential to deplete your 401k balance if it is under $7,000. Small balances might even be automatically transferred into underperforming Safe Harbor IRAs, which often charge high fees and deliver returns that can fall below 2%. Additionally, an account balance under $1,000 may be immediately cashed out if you don't act promptly, resulting in a taxable payout and penalty.

Ways to Speed Up the Rollover Process

The process of rolling over a 401k might be challenging, but it is essential to act swiftly. TopBuild employees should manage their rollovers proactively to reduce the risk of delays and the resulting financial consequences. Understanding that a 401k rollover is a multi-step procedure and that any delays can incur significant costs is the first step. Savova of PensionBee emphasizes the importance of not only starting the process as soon as possible but also staying involved throughout.

Although there may not be many options for providers when transferring a 401k from a previous job to a new 401k, it’s important to choose a provider that offers efficient and customer-focused services if you decide to roll your money into an IRA. To reduce delays caused by traditional mail, seek providers offering digital-first solutions with automatic tracking. You can mitigate the risks of checks in the mail and long delays by choosing a service with an efficient digital rollover process.

Moreover, customer service quality is crucial. A reliable provider will follow up with the previous plan administrator and proactively handle the paperwork associated with the rollover. They should also keep you updated at every stage to help prevent any surprises or unexpected delays.

Delaying your 401k rollover could also impact your ability to make required minimum distributions (RMDs) when you turn 73. Complex RMD calculations can arise if you don't roll over your 401k to an IRA, especially if you have multiple 401k accounts. Financial planning becomes more complicated when previous accounts are not consolidated into a single IRA, as the IRS requires RMDs to be taken from tax-deferred accounts starting at age 73.
